Littleton's Summit Ridge Middle School serves grades 7-8 in the Jeffco Public Schools district. It is among the few public middle schools in Colorado to receive a distinguished GreatSchools Rating of 9 out of 10.
This school has an average Community Rating of 5 out of 5 stars, based on reviews from 11 school community members.

I have had all of my children attend this school over the past 5 years and I can tell you that it goes through a LOT of senior office staff changes. The teaches overall are VERY attentive and do their best with the time and number of students they have. They are very good about requesting students stay after when necessary, but it is a very structured curriculum and either the students get it, or they dont. The teachers really don't go into too much depth. Behavior and other structure is very controled and works well for the school.
